F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Temas de Hoy |
|
Herramientas | Buscar en Tema | Desplegado |
|
#1
|
|||
|
|||
Filtrar un resultado en DBGRID desde dos combobox
Buenas,
Tengo un problema, tengo una base de datos con un campo MES que me guarda el nombre del mes en curso, eje.: Marzo, Abril, Agosto. Tengo un formulario con un DBGRID donde quiero mostrar un resultado, el hecho es que tengo dos combobox "CMBDESDE" y "CMBHASTA" quiero que en el DBGRID se me filtren los resultados que seleccione en los dos combobox, es decir; Coloco en CMBDESDE: Enero y en CMBHASTA: Abril, en el dbgrid me mostraria todos los resultados que esten entre Enero y Abril (Enero, Febrero, Marzo, Abril) Sera posible una mano para eso...estoy algo parado en este paso! Gracias
__________________
"Ningun precio es alto por el privilegio de ser uno mismo..." |
#2
|
||||
|
||||
en el evento onChange de los combos:
__________________
self.free; |
#3
|
|||
|
|||
No me muestra resultado alguno en el dbgrid!
__________________
"Ningun precio es alto por el privilegio de ser uno mismo..." |
#4
|
||||
|
||||
me parece que en lugar de filtrar por el nombre del mes debes hacer un artificio para filtrar por el "numero" del mes
__________________
Dulce Regalo que Satanas manda para mi..... |
#5
|
||||
|
||||
Hola.
Por supuesto funciona si en los combos tenés los nombres de los meses y asignas ComboBoxChange al evento OnChange de los dos combos... Un saludo.
__________________
Daniel Didriksen Guía de estilo - Uso de las etiquetas - La otra guía de estilo .... Última edición por ecfisa fecha: 27-04-2011 a las 19:24:16. |
#6
|
|||
|
|||
Muchas gracias por su ayuda, hice exactamente lo que me dijiste...le asigne Comboboxchange a ambos comobox, y ajuste el codigo a mi proyecto...Sin embargo los resultados no se ajustan a lo que quiero! Explico:
Si Selecciono ENERO y DICIEMBRE no me muestra resultados... Si selecciono ENERO y NOVIEMBRE me muestra solo algunos resultados (ENERO, FEBRERO, MARZO, MAYO, JULIO, JUNIO, NOVIEMBRE) aun cuando también tengo ABRIL, DICIEMBRE en mis registros... ¿A que podría deberse?
__________________
"Ningun precio es alto por el privilegio de ser uno mismo..." |
#7
|
||||
|
||||
no lo se no he podido hacer pruebas
pero me parece que deberias hacer el filtro por numero de mes en lugar de nombre de mes salvo error u omision
__________________
Dulce Regalo que Satanas manda para mi..... |
|
|
Temas Similares | ||||
Tema | Autor | Foro | Respuestas | Último mensaje |
Se puede? (Filtrar desde dentro de un DBGrid?) | b3nshi | Conexión con bases de datos | 3 | 27-04-2010 20:57:09 |
Filtrar un campo en un ComboBox | zeta2 | Varios | 12 | 02-07-2008 11:17:41 |
Filtrar ADOTable al seleccionar combobox | jeysi | Varios | 3 | 24-01-2008 09:48:36 |
FastReport - ComboBox y resultado SQL | hecospina | Varios | 6 | 23-01-2008 22:19:30 |
Multiplicando el resultado de un ComboBox | Camilo | Conexión con bases de datos | 10 | 06-12-2007 17:57:14 |
|